Senior Human Resource Specialist
GAP Solutions, Inc. (GAPSI)
NOTE: THIS POSITION IS FULLY REMOTE!
Position Objective: As a Senior Human Resource Specialist, apply a broad range of advanced skills and expertise in the full range of federal HR areas including but not limited to staffing, classification, processing, benefits, recruitment, compensation, SES programs, work life programs, policy and employee and labor relations. In support of the Dept. of Homeland Security (DHS), U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E), Office of Human Capital (OHC), Human Resources Operations Center (HROC).
Staffing Activities
Review position applications to determine basic qualifications, adjudicate veterans' preference, and prepare selection certificates for issue.
Apply pay setting calculations for use by to extend job offers.
Perform law enforcement pay setting to include accurate conversion of general pay and special pay schedules to the law enforcement pay schedule.
Develop and review standard operating procedures (SOP) and job aids for existing, new, or emerging staffing programs.
Develop and build specialized ad-hoc applicant metrics, reports, and associated spreadsheets.
Validate applicant selections.
Interpret and apply laws, rules, and regulations, to include Executive Orders (EO's) Title 38, Delegated Examining Unit (DEU) regulations, 5 Code of Federal Regulations (CFR), the Vet Guide, and other regulatory guidance to federal hiring actions.
Respond to applicant and internal customer concerns and inquiries.
Review applicant status determinations when challenged by internal/external candidates and managers.
Monitor, revise, and maintain reports and files.
Develop staffing process checklists and maintain tracking spreadsheets.
Coordinate and serve as a liaison with customers as required.
Perform data entry into position management and other related ICE systems as required.
Prepare, issue, and track tentative selection notices.
Coordinate job offers, release requests, setting of enter-on-duty (EOD) dates, and coordinate training classes for applicants.
Coordinate issuance and return of security paperwork for applicants including Electronic Questionnaires for Investigations Processing (e-QIP) initiations and conduct regular status checks with the ICE Personnel Security Division (PSD).
Familiarity with USA Staffing Record EOD actions in ICE databases as required.
Assist with audit of staffing and recruitment case files.
Perform quality assurance for the oral interview process and enter results into appropriate ICE databases.
Advise and assist hiring managers in performing job analyses to fill existing or new positions: draft vacancy announcements, develop interview questions, score benchmarks based on job analysis results, and guidance on forming interview panels.
Participate and/or contribute as an active member of a team for human capital initiative(s).
Provide support for HR specialists who perform recruitment and staffing duties for an assigned block of services.
Instruct candidates on the proper way to complete and submit employment applications and review for complete and accurate information.
Explain basic merit promotion procedures to employees.
Maintain merit promotion folders to keep accurate logs.
Initiate the pre-employment process to include security, medical, drug and/or fitness tests as required for the position.
Download and transmit SF75 information to other Federal agencies as required.
Operational Classification Activities
Lead a group of contractor staff with the daily processing of Position Management System Online (PMSO) Builds, SF-52 routing, and SF-corrections as applicable.
Operate several independent HR processing systems (e.g., TOPS, NFC, ESP).
Assign SF-52s and HC Link service tickets ensuring a balance of tickets among contractor staff.
Monitor ESP and HC Link work request submissions and timely assign for processing.
Keep abreast of the status and progress of work, and make day-to-day adjustments in accordance with established priorities, and obtain assistance from the Section Chiefs on problems that arise, such as backlogs.
Aid contractor staff with specific tasks and job techniques.
Perform routine work in progress checks.
Run system generated reports from numerous HR systems for use by various HR Units and ICE program office.
Coordinate with other HROC Units in the correction of SF-52's.

Operational Processing Activities
Process Personnel Actions (SF52) in compliance with Department of Homeland Security (DHS), Office of Personnel Management (OPM) and National Finance Center (NFC) rules and procedures, processes recruitment, Career Ladder Promotion (CLP), Change to Lower Grade (CLG). Detail actions, Temporary Promotions (TPRO), Law Enforcement Pay Actions, Administratively Uncontrollable Overtime (AUO), Reassignment actions etc.
Apply a wide range of personnel, payroll and benefit concepts, laws, policies practices, analytical and diagnostic methods to address technical issues:
Development of SOPs for existing, new, or emerging personnel functions.
Provide administrative support by responding to questions, complaints, problems, or situations, and providing explanation of policy and procedures.
Support audit - KPMG, A-123, ICU, Internal and external audits - provide guidance, documentation.
-Provide technical assistance to end users on HR automated systems, procedures, and applications.
Review, assign, and route SF52s to process personnel actions in ESP related to the duties of the section.
Train and monitor the workload of HRAs to ensure they perform duties accurately and timely.
Perform daily monitoring of personnel systems for actions related to the duties of the section, following up with the employee and or services for missing information.
Process complex settlement case/tasking requiring History Correction Process (HCUP) by providing analysis of alternative options on a full range of pay-related issues.
Support research and investigation of facts involving personnel problems and other projects.
Test enhancements projects with the Human Resources Information Technology (HRIT) team.
Monitor and maintain human resources reports and files.
Research discrepancies with benefits, veterans' preference, and SCDs, etc.
Operational Retirement & Benefits Activities
Provide federal benefits expertise to advise current and former employees, annuitants, eligible family members, and managers on complex benefits problems and inquiries.
Provide individual employee counseling on retirement options; Thrift Savings Plan (TSP) and worker's compensation/injury benefits; and eligibility requirements for life, health, and long-term health insurance.
Research employee eOPF issues/errors related to benefits and conduct service audits.
Provide solutions and develop corrective guidance or operating procedures to know concerns.
Assist to process documents related to benefits to include retirement packages.
Process SF52 documents for retirements and death in service actions.
Prepare retirement and survivor benefits computation for law enforcement and non-law enforcement employees.
Assist employees and survivors in preparing retirement applicants, ensuring documentation is accurate and submitted within required deadlines.
Provide counseling to employees on all aspects of the TSP to include participation eligibility, eligibility for retroactive TSP error corrections, and to employees leaving federal service (or their survivors) on the benefits available from their TSP accounts.
Provide validation of retirement coverage to pay technicians.
Prepare communication related to employee benefit and retirement materials to ensure supervisors and employees are fully and currently informed.
Administer the Federal Employees Group Life Insurance (FEGLI) and the Federal Employees Health Benefits (FEHB) programs for serviced activities.
Establish local procedures, publicity, and informational materials related to the FEGLI and FEHB programs.
Advise employees and supervisors on difficult questions relating to FEGLI and FEHB (Typical issues involve interpreting provisions of the Spouse Equity Act, and the Temporary Continuation of FEHB Coverage Program; interpretation and applicability of Comptroller General decisions pertaining to retroactive payments; and determining enrollment eligibility for initial coverage outside the normal enrollment periods).

Qualifications
Basic Qualifications:
Master's Degree required
10 years of federal Human Resources experience (can be either working as a federal employee or government contractor supporting a federal agency).
Delegated Examining Certification and HRM Certificate from an accredited academic institution.
When a Task Order includes tasks related to drug testing and site collection, the candidate must possess knowledge of Health and Human Services Guidelines for federal drug testing and possess a valid driver's license. The contractor candidates must be capable of air travel.
Must be U.S. citizen or Legal Permanent Resident and must currently reside in the United States or its Territories. Additionally, employees are required to have resided within the United States or its Territories for three or more years out of the last five.
Preferred Qualifications:
Intermediate to advanced technical proficiency in the full Microsoft Office Suite.
Strong written and oral communication skills.
Advanced presentation skills.
Ability to work effectively within a group or individually.
Advanced organization and leadership skills.
Understanding and familiarity with industry best practices.
Exceptional time management skills.
Depending on the specific tasks, may be required to have advanced knowledge of NFC, eOPF, WebTA, SharePoint, Oracle, Java Script, SQL, and other information technology system.
